In many ways i'm rather enjoying this current quarantine lifestyle. I like that people are advised to social space, 6 feet is okay, i'd prefer 6 miles. Few people in the stores. But there are certain times of the day when there's long lines outside and many people in the store. I've seen a couple of instances where a person will be a total a-hole to people. The direction arrows in Walmart are mostly ignored, good intentions but unnecessary if everyone just social spaces accordingly. With many things opening up around here in my area of southern California, a rise in positive covid-19 cases has also come with it. Which I expected, as many are testing their employees as a precautionary measure. Most are asymptomatic or don't require hospitalization. From what I hear from other people (rumors), most positive test results seem to be coming from people who go across the border to Mexicali, Mexico for non-essential reasons. One morning at Walmart a lady got mad at me for having 2 bottles of clorox cleaning disinfectant spray and 2 containers of wipes, the limit is 1 per family. I told her I was shopping for 2 families, my mom and grandmother(who recently turned 95). After that she calmed down. Rubbing alcohol and hand sanitizer are shoot and miss still. They are becoming more frequent lately in the 99c stores. At first they had a limit of 2 per item, now its only 1 hand sanitizer per family, no limit on the rubbing alcohol. Eggs and toilet paper are also starting to make a more consistent comeback on the shelves. Well, that's what is happening around here.
